SYA is an awesome rescue. My husband and I have adopted 4 standard donkeys, 2 mini donkeys, and 1 mini mule from SYA. Ann is a very caring person who takes excellent care of the rescues, nursing them back to health and finding them their perfect homes. And she is always available after adopting for your questions or advice. Each animal gets individual attention and lots of love. 3 of my donkeys were in bad shape when they came into the rescue but thanks to Ann and SYA, they are now thriving.

Save Your Ass Long Ear Rescue is a great organization that rescues, cares for, and finds good home for donkeys and mules that have been abused, neglected, or are just no longer wanted. These beautiful animals come to the farm in pretty bad shape, many never having been handled with kindness. The women who 'run' this organization are very much hands on experienced donkey & mule owners who know how to provide these wonderful animals with the environment, care, and training they so desperately need.
